Shares of The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company (NASDAQ:GT - Get Free Report) hit a new 52-week low during trading on Monday . The company traded as low as $7.46 and last traded at $7.59, with a volume of 1793970 shares traded. The stock had previously closed at $7.86.

Goodyear Tire & Rubber Stock Performance
The company has a market capitalization of $2.14 billion, a PE ratio of 5.25, a PEG ratio of 0.96 and a beta of 1.37. The company has a quick ratio of 0.63, a current ratio of 1.15 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.24. The company has a 50-day moving average price of $9.02 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$9.95.
Goodyear Tire & Rubber (NASDAQ:GT -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, August 7th. The company reported ($0.17)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.14 by ($0.31). The firm had revenue of $4.47 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.50 billion. Goodyear Tire & Rubber had a return on equity of 3.17% and a net margin of 2.22%.The company's revenue for the quarter was down 2.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the firm earned $0.19 EPS. Analysts predict that The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company will post 1.5 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Goodyear Tire & Rubber

Goodyear Tire & Rubber Co engages in the development, manufacture, distribution, and sale of tires. It operates through the following geographical segments: Americas, Europe, Middle East, and Africa, and Asia Pacific. The Americas segment is involved in the development, manufacture, distribution, and sale of tires and related products and services in North, Central, and South America.
